Heating Oil | $.780 per gallon |
Propane 1 | $1.093 per gallon |
Kerosene | $1.024 per gallon |
Electricity 2 | $.142 per kilowatt-hour |
Natural Gas 3 | $.784 per therm4 |
Gasoline (Self-Serve Regular) | $.987 per gallon |
Diesel | $1.135 per gallon |
1 Propane average based on 900 to 1000 gallons annual
consumption.
2 Average price is taken from the US Department of Energy Electric Power
Monthly- November 1998 - with data for August 1998. Average is the total monthly revenue
divided by monthly sales for the residential sector.
3 Natural Gas rate is the most recent Winter Domestic Heat net rate for Energy
North Natural Gas. Winter rate begins on November 1. Monthly customer charge is not
included in the average. Rate is for first 80 therms only, rate is reduced after 80
therms.
4 A therm equals 100,000 Btu (British Thermal Units)
